True or False? There were no kids allowed aboard the Titanic.
False- 112 children were aboard, the largest number of which were in third class.

True or False? When the Titanic was sinking, there were other ships nearby that could have helped.
True- The ship they spotted in the distance didnât answer. One ship did reply and was on it's way... but the Carpathia was 58 miles away.

True or False? There were animals on the Titanic.
True- The ship carried at least twelve dogs, only three of which survived. First-class passengers often traveled with their pets.

If you compared the Titanic to the size of a football field, how many football fields long was the Titanic? A) 1 B) 2 C) 3 D) 4
C) 3 (The Titanic was almost three football fields long and one football field wide & about as tall as a 17-story building)
